Dynamic Invariant Detectors (Daikon) Daikon, in contrast, is a dynamic invariant detector for Java, C, and C++. It does not perform any analysis on the program. In fact, it does not use the source code at all when inferring invariants and does not initially require any programmer-provided annotations, although it will accept guidance. Run the Daikon invariant detector via the command java -cp $DAIKONDIR/www.doorway.ru www.doorway.ru \ [ flags ] dtrace-files \ [ decls-files ] [ spinfo-files The dtrace-files are data trace .dtrace) files containing variable values from an execution of the target program. The Daikon invariant detector is named after an Asian radish. “Daikon” is pronounced like the combination of the two one-syllable English words “die-con”.
